Output 3c15d94aa8fd66efbc421aa78198f5cc9704d5bbf1420743b2c84757b29d5570:1

value
82520
script pubkey
OP_0 OP_PUSHBYTES_20 57b76425984248b4aa8cbcb66cabb49535b32970
address
bc1q27mkgfvcgfytf25vhjmxe2a5j56mx2ts9va39w
transaction
3c15d94aa8fd66efbc421aa78198f5cc9704d5bbf1420743b2c84757b29d5570
spent
true